 | #include "src/tint/fuzzers/tint_spirv_tools_fuzzer/mutator_cache.h" | 
 |  | 
 | namespace tint::fuzzers::spvtools_fuzzer { | 
 |  | 
 | MutatorCache::MutatorCache(size_t max_size) : map_(), entries_(), max_size_(max_size) { | 
 |     assert(max_size && "`max_size` may not be 0"); | 
 | } | 
 |  | 
 | MutatorCache::Value::pointer MutatorCache::Get(const Key& key) { | 
 |     auto it = map_.find(key); | 
 |     if (it == map_.end()) { | 
 |         return nullptr; | 
 |     } | 
 |     UpdateUsage(it); | 
 |     return entries_.front().second.get(); | 
 | } | 
 |  | 
 | void MutatorCache::Put(const Key& key, Value value) { | 
 |     assert(value && "Mutator cache can't have nullptr unique_ptr"); | 
 |     auto it = map_.find(key); | 
 |     if (it != map_.end()) { | 
 |         it->second->second = std::move(value); | 
 |         UpdateUsage(it); | 
 |     } else { | 
 |         if (map_.size() == max_size_) { | 
 |             Remove(*entries_.back().first); | 
 |         } | 
 |  | 
 |         entries_.emplace_front(nullptr, std::move(value)); | 
 |         auto pair = map_.emplace(key, entries_.begin()); | 
 |         assert(pair.second && "The key must be unique"); | 
 |         entries_.front().first = &pair.first->first; | 
 |     } | 
 | } | 
 |  | 
 | MutatorCache::Value MutatorCache::Remove(const Key& key) { | 
 |     auto it = map_.find(key); | 
 |     if (it == map_.end()) { | 
 |         return nullptr; | 
 |     } | 
 |     auto result = std::move(it->second->second); | 
 |     entries_.erase(it->second); | 
 |     map_.erase(it); | 
 |     return result; | 
 | } | 
 |  | 
 | size_t MutatorCache::KeyHash::operator()(const std::vector<uint32_t>& vec) const { | 
 |     return std::hash<std::u32string>()({vec.begin(), vec.end()}); | 
 | } | 
 |  | 
 | void MutatorCache::UpdateUsage(Map::iterator it) { | 
 |     auto entry = std::move(*it->second); | 
 |     entries_.erase(it->second); | 
 |     entries_.push_front(std::move(entry)); | 
 |     it->second = entries_.begin(); | 
 | } | 
 |  | 
 | }  // namespace tint::fuzzers::spvtools_fuzzer |
